Honeymoon Itinerary in Bali

Friday, December 15: Arrival in Bali

Welcome to Bali! Start your honeymoon by checking into your hotel and relaxing after the long journey. Take a stroll along the beautiful Kuta Beach in the afternoon, known for its stunning sunsets. In the evening, indulge in a romantic dinner at one of the beachfront restaurants.

  • Kuta Beach: Free, 2 hours
Saturday, December 16: Ubud Cultural Experience

Begin your day by visiting the iconic Ubud Monkey Forest in the morning, where you can observe and interact with the playful monkeys. Afterward, explore the traditional art market in Ubud, where you can find unique crafts and souvenirs. In the evening, enjoy a traditional Balinese dance performance.

  • Ubud Monkey Forest: $5, 2 hours
  • Ubud Art Market: Free entry, 1 hour
  • Balinese Dance Performance: $15, 2 hours
Sunday, December 17: Mount Batur Sunrise Hike

Start your day early with a sunrise hike to the top of Mount Batur. Enjoy breathtaking views of the sunrise over the volcanic landscape. After the hike, relax at the natural hot springs in Toya Bungkah and rejuvenate before heading back to your hotel.

  • Mount Batur Sunrise Hike: $50, 5 hours
  • Toya Bungkah Hot Springs: $15, 2 hours
Monday, December 18: Nusa Penida Island Tour

Embark on a full-day tour to Nusa Penida Island, known for its stunning cliffs and crystal-clear waters. Visit the famous Kelingking Beach, Angel's Billabong, and Broken Beach. Relax and swim at Crystal Bay before returning to Bali in the evening.

  • Nusa Penida Island Tour: $70, 10 hours
Tuesday, December 19: Explore Tanah Lot and Uluwatu

In the morning, visit the iconic Tanah Lot Temple, perched on a rocky outcrop overlooking the ocean. Enjoy the breathtaking scenery and explore the surrounding area. In the afternoon, head to Uluwatu Temple, located atop a cliff, and witness the mesmerizing Kecak Fire Dance during sunset.

  • Tanah Lot Temple: $3, 2 hours
  • Uluwatu Temple and Kecak Dance: $10, 3 hours
Wednesday, December 20: Waterfalls and Rice Terraces

Discover the natural beauty of Bali by visiting the stunning Tegenungan Waterfall in the morning. Continue your journey to the Tegalalang Rice Terraces, where you can take in the panoramic views of the terraced fields. In the evening, enjoy a romantic dinner overlooking the rice terraces.

  • Tegenungan Waterfall: $2, 2 hours
  • Tegalalang Rice Terraces: Free entry, 2 hours

Thursday, December 21: Beach Day and Sunset Dinner Cruise

Spend your last day in Bali relaxing on the beautiful Seminyak Beach. Enjoy swimming, sunbathing, or taking a leisurely walk along the shore. In the evening, embark on a romantic sunset dinner cruise and savor a delicious meal while enjoying the stunning views of the Bali coastline.

  • Seminyak Beach: Free, 4 hours
  • Sunset Dinner Cruise: $80, 4 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For a unique and off the beaten path experience, consider visiting the secluded Nungnung Waterfall, located in the heart of Bali's rainforest. Another hidden gem is the Tirta Gangga Water Palace, known for its serene gardens and beautiful pools. These lesser-known attractions offer a peaceful and intimate experience for honeymooners seeking tranquility.
